Ginkgo Biloba Prevention Trial in Older Individuals

ClinicalTrials.gov ID: NCT00010803

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

This study will determine the effect of 240mg/day Ginkgo biloba in decreasing the incidence of dementia and specifically Alzheimer's disease (AD), slowing cognitive decline and functional disability, reducing incidence of cardiovascular disease, and decreasing total mortality.
